Kalām, Russell’s Teapots, and the Flying Spaghetti Monster Shaykh Hamza Karamali | Basira Education Sunday November 22nd, 2020 | 1:00 PM CST Description: New Atheists argue that evolution and atheism go hand-in-hand, that belief in God is like belief in Russell’s teapots, and that disbelief in evolution is like belief in the Flying Spaghetti Monster. Hamza Karamali will introduce these new atheist arguments and show how they are valid (and, in fact, strong) arguments against Christian theism, but how they are completely inapplicable to the Islamic theism of the traditional scholars of kalām . Biography: Hamza Karamali has studied the Islamic sciences with distinguished traditional scholars in Jordan, Kuwait, and UAE, as well as earning a Bachelor’s and Master’s degrees in Islamic Law and Legal Theory from Jamia Nizamiyya in Hyderabad, India. He teaching and research work has been part of several organizations such as SunniPath, Qibla, the Qasid Institute, and Kalām Research & Media. As of late, his research and educational projects work around the integration of modern analytic philosophy and science with traditional Islamic theology and logic. In the summer of 2019, he founded Basira Education to fill a gap in the religious education of Muslims in the modern world — his goal at Basira is to develop a deploy an original seminary-level curriculum that is grounded in the traditional Islamic sciences but fully integrates modern science and culture into an intelligent and God-centered worldview. Darul Qasim is an institute of traditional Islamic higher learning headquartered in Glendale Heights, a suburb of Chicago, IL. It aims to offer academic services through the lens of traditional Sunni understanding — the added value that incorporates the need to procure salvation in the Hereafter.
